A photo of Deng Yingchao and his younger generation. The one wearing white clothes has lived with Premier Zhou and his wife for more than ten years
This photo was taken on May 20, 1977 and was taken at the West Flower Hall of Zhongnanhai, Beijing. From left in front row of photos: Zhou Bingyi and Zhou Bingjian. From left to the back row of the photos: Zhou Bingjun, Zhou Bingde, Deng Yingchao, Zhou Binghe, Zhou Binghua.
These six juniors are actually the children of Premier Zhou Enshou’s third brother. Zhou Bingde is Zhou Enshou's eldest daughter, and she is also the only eldest daughter of the Zhou family in three generations. The Zhou family was very happy with Zhou Bingde's birth and regarded her as the pearl in the big family.
When the founding of the People's Republic of China was just now, everyone's living conditions were not good, and Zhou Enshou had many children in his family. Premier Zhou and his wife suggested taking Zhou Bingde to Xihua Hall to live.
It’s like this. Since 1949, 12-year-old Zhou Bingde came to live with his uncle Premier Zhou and his uncle Deng Yingchao. She has lived there for more than ten years.
Premier Zhou and Sister Deng have no children in their lives. With Zhou Bingde's company, the West Flower Hall is filled with laughter and joy every day.
From this photo, we can see that Zhou Bingde and Deng Yingchao have the best relationship.
Since Premier Zhou’s death in 1976, Zhou Bingde and his younger siblings will come to the West Flower Hall to accompany their aunt whenever they have time.
These children are not only very filial, but also inherit the noble character of Premier Zhou and his wife. They have never made any profit for themselves in the name of Premier Zhou. They always live the life of ordinary people and always work down-to-earth.
Zhou Bingde later said, "Among our Zhou brothers and sisters, we are ordinary people. No one is a high-ranking official, no one makes big money in business, no small car or a big house."
Premier Zhou and his wife did not leave them any material property, but left them with endless spiritual wealth.
